India’s ties with Africa send a message of “stability” and “reliability” in a turbulent global environment, External Affairs Minister S. Jaishankar said while launching the theme, logo and website for the fourth India-Africa Forum Summit in New Delhi. He said the partnership has gained greater importance as the world faces complex geopolitical and geo-economic pressures.

Tamil Nadu recorded more than 84% polling in the 2026 Assembly election, with the turnout being described as the highest ever in the state’s electoral history. West Bengal recorded brisk polling in the first phase of the 2026 Assembly election, with voter turnout touching nearly 90% by 5 pm and Dakshin Dinajpur emerging as the district with the highest participation.
